If you have a double-glazed window that is misted it is a sign of a leak between the glass panes, or an issue with the seal. A specialized repair method can be utilized to eliminate the moisture and clean the glass unit and put in a new spacer bar and a desiccant to prevent future condensation. The repair can be completed at home or on the spot and is typically less expensive than replacing the entire window.

Replacing a damaged double pane is the most cost-effective choice but it's not always feasible to replace only the glass. Double-pane windows have a gap between the two glass panes that is sealed by argon or krypton gas to create an airtight seal. This reduces energy loss. To maintain energy efficiency and ensure a tight airtight seal it is often necessary to replace the entire window when a single glass pane breaks.

Misted Double Glazing

Double glazing that has been contaminated can pose a threat to homeowners. It can impact how your windows function and could cause dampness, mould and high energy bills. As winter draws near it is essential to solve any issues with double glazing repaired as quickly as you can.

Misting occurs when the window glass has condensation formed between the glass panes. This usually happens due to poor installation or air infiltration. The best way to avoid this is to use the FENSA approved window installer.

Keep your double-glazed windows free of dust, dirt and other debris. Applying warm soapy water to the frames is the most efficient way to clean most upvc window repair double glazing. However, if the frames are made from wood or aluminium, you might need to look at other methods of cleaning them thoroughly.

Double glazing owners often report that their doors and windows are difficult to open or shut after installation. Extreme temperatures can cause the frame to expand or contract depending on the weather. Try to adjust the hinges, handles, and mechanisms using cold or hot water. If this doesn't work then you should get in touch with the company that installed your double glazing. They might be able to provide a repair or refund.

If your double-glazed windows are beginning to fog, it could mean that the seal in between the two panes of glass has failed. There are a number of reasons, which include old age, poor installation or the use of harsh cleaners or oils. You should also choose an installer who is FENSA-regulated to make sure that your double glazing is in compliance completely with UK building regulations.

In certain situations, you can repair the double-glazing unit that is misted by replacing the spacer bars with ones that are a little warmer. This will help reduce condensation by raising the temperature of the glass. Alternately, you can opt for thermally efficient glass that has low emission coatings and argon gas between the glass to further reduce condensation.
